PLC (Programmable Logic Controller) 是一种专门用于自动化控制的电子设备。它可以根据预先编写好的程序,对机器或工艺进行自动控制。西门子PLC S7-200是一种经典的小型PLC控制器,常用于工厂自动化、机器控制等领域。
S7-200 PLC的基本构成包括CPU模块、电源模块、输入输出模块、通信模块等。CPU模块是PLC的核心,它负责处理程序逻辑、控制输入输出模块等。电源模块提供电源供电,输入输出模块则负责从外部读取信号或输出控制信号。通信模块可以实现与其它设备的通讯,比如上位机、人机界面等。
PLC程序采用类似于C语言的结构化程序设计方法,常用的程序语言为ladder diagram(梯形图)和statement list(语句列表)。梯形图是一种常用的编程方式,它通过逻辑元件(如继电器、计数器、定时器等)的组合来实现程序控制。语句列表则更接近于传统的C语言编程风格,适合于程序逻辑比较复杂的情况。
PLC程序的编写需要遵循严格的规范,如模块化程序设计、输入输出信号的正确匹配、程序逻辑的清晰性等。PLC程序的调试需要使用专门的编程软件,如西门子提供的STEP 7 Micro/WIN。通过编程软件,可以实现程序的下载、在线调试、存储等功能。
总之,PLC西门子S7-200 是一种小型但功能强大的PLC控制器,它可以实现工厂自动化、机器控制等方面的自动化控制。对于想要从事自动化控制领域的工程师来说,掌握PLC的基础知识是非常重要的。